|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 532 人关注过本帖
标题:帮我改一下这个求勒让德多项式的程序
取消只看楼主 加入收藏
诸葛欧阳
Rank: 19Rank: 19Rank: 19Rank: 19Rank: 19Rank: 19
来 自:流年
等 级:贵宾
威 望:82
帖 子:2790
专家分:14619
注 册:2014-10-16
结帖率:95.45%
收藏
已结贴  问题点数:4 回复次数:1 
帮我改一下这个求勒让德多项式的程序
程序代码:
#include "stdafx.h"
#include<stdio.h>
int p(int n)
{   int n;
    char x;
    if(n==0)p(n)=1;
    else if(n==1)p(n)=x;
         else p(n)=((2n-1)*p(n-1)-(n-1)p(n-2))/n;
return p(n);
}
int main()
{
    int n;
    int p(n);
    scanf("%d",&n);
    printf("%d",p(n));
    return 0;
}
请各位帮我改一下,用该程序求N阶勒让德多项式的值,n=0,p(x)=1.  n=1,p(x)=x.  n>1,p(x)=((2n-1)*p(n-1)-(n-1)p(n-2))/n
搜索更多相关主题的帖子: 多项式 
2014-10-22 10:46
诸葛欧阳
Rank: 19Rank: 19Rank: 19Rank: 19Rank: 19Rank: 19
来 自:流年
等 级:贵宾
威 望:82
帖 子:2790
专家分:14619
注 册:2014-10-16
收藏
得分:0 
程序代码:
#include "stdafx.h"
#include<stdio.h>
int p(int n)
{   int n;
    char x;
    if(n==0)p(n)=1;
    else if(n==1)p(n)=x;
         else p(n)=((2n-1)*p(n-1)-(n-1)p(n-2))/n;
return p(n);
}
int main()
{
    int n;
    int p(n);
    scanf("%d",&n);
    printf("%d",p(n));
    return 0;
}
简化后还不行`,求大神帮忙改一下

一片落叶掉进了回忆的流年。
2014-10-22 11:58
快速回复:帮我改一下这个求勒让德多项式的程序
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.032548 second(s), 8 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ved